How does the Verizon Wireless handset work with the OnStar system?

0

A. A subscriber to Nationwide Calling with OnStar may use their minutes to make and receive calls using the Verizon Wireless handset or OnStar Hands-Free Calling. If a customer wishes to transfer any incoming calls to the vehicle to take advantage of the benefits of the OnStar Hands-Free Calling, they can choose from two options: – Immediate Call Forwarding – The user can forward all calls from the Verizon Wireless handset directly to the vehicle. – Conditional Call Forwarding (No Answer/Busy Transfer) – The user’s Verizon Wireless handset will ring approximately four times before it is forwarded to the vehicle. Q. When using OnStar Hands-Free Calling, are customers still able to receive call-waiting and voicemail? A. The call-waiting option is not available in the vehicle. Voicemail is not available when forwarding calls from the Verizon Wireless handset to the OnStar Hands-Free Calling.
